Seasonal Air Duct Cleaning Care for Vancouver: Year-Round Homeowner’s Guide
In September 2020, air quality in Vancouver hit hazardous AQI levels for over a week during wildfire season. Every home running its HVAC system during that period pulled particulate into its duct system that a standard filter couldn’t capture. Homeowners who didn’t address it were still circulating that residue months later — because nobody told them that wildfire smoke is a seasonal cleaning trigger, not just a filter change event. This guide maps exactly what your duct system faces across Vancouver’s four seasons and what to do about it, based on what we’ve found inspecting thousands of systems in Clark County since 2018.
Quick Answer
Vancouver homeowners should treat duct care as four distinct seasonal tasks rather than one annual cleaning. Fall demands pre-heating inspection for accumulated summer debris; winter requires monitoring condensation in crawlspace runs; spring calls for post-pollen and construction dust assessment; and summer wildfire season needs proactive filtration upgrades and post-smoke system evaluation. Your home’s specific timing depends on its age, duct material, and whether your HVAC sits in a crawlspace or attic.

Fall: The First Heating Cycle Is Your Biggest Air Quality Event
When you flip your thermostat to heat for the first time each October or November, you’re not just warming your house — you’re recirculating everything that settled in your ducts during six months of dormancy. Dust, skin cells, pollen that slipped past filters, and whatever your summer activities stirred up: it all gets pushed into your living space in that first cycle. In our experience across Vancouver homes from Hough to Fishers Landing, the initial heating startup produces the highest particulate concentration of the entire year.
Here’s what happens specifically in Clark County’s climate. Our relatively dry summers allow dust to accumulate undisturbed. Then fall arrives with shorter days and that first cold snap. Homes near Vancouver’s older neighborhoods like Arnada or Carter Park — with original ductwork from the 1960s-80s — often have fiberglass-lined ducts that hold more debris than modern metal systems. When heat hits that lining, you get that distinctive “first burn” smell that’s actually baked dust and organic material.
What to do before you turn the heat on:
- Inspect your return air grilles. If you see visible dust buildup at the entry points, the interior is worse. This takes two minutes and tells you whether September’s wildfire residue is still circulating.
- Change your filter, but don’t stop there. A new filter won’t remove what’s already coating your duct walls. In Vancouver’s fall, we recommend MERV 11-13 filters for homes near high-traffic corridors like Mill Plain or Fourth Plain — they capture smaller particles without overloading residential blowers.
- Run your system on “fan only” for 30 minutes first. This circulates air without heating elements engaged, letting your filter catch some loose debris before it bakes onto heat exchangers.
- Schedule duct inspection if it’s been over 18 months. For homes in Cascade Highlands or areas near recent construction, fall is ideal — before heating season stress and after summer’s dust load has settled.
We’ve found that Vancouver homeowners who address fall buildup before heating season report fewer respiratory irritations and less filter clogging through winter. Winter: Condensation and Microbial Growth in Crawlspace Ducts
Vancouver’s winter temperature swings create a specific duct problem that homeowners never see: condensation inside crawlspace duct runs. Our Pacific Northwest climate produces 40-50°F temperature differentials between cold crawlspaces and heated air moving through ducts. When warm air hits cold metal, moisture forms. In fiberglass-lined ducts, that moisture gets trapped. In unlined metal ducts, it pools at low points.
We’ve crawled through enough Vancouver crawlspaces — from the damp lowlands near the Columbia River to the hillside homes above Burnt Bridge Creek — to know this pattern well. January and February are when we get the most calls about musty smells when heat runs. By then, the microbial growth is established. The real damage started in November, when first-heating condensation met summer dust deposits.
Warning signs specific to Vancouver winters:
- Musty odor that intensifies when heat first cycles on, then fades — this means moisture is reactivating dormant growth
- Condensation on duct exterior in crawlspaces, especially where ducts pass near foundation vents (common in Vancouver’s older homes with original venting)
- Uneven heating between rooms, particularly in homes with duct runs through unconditioned garage ceilings — a frequent design in Vancouver’s 1970s-90s subdivisions
- Increased filter changes needed; moisture-loaded dust cakes faster
The solution isn’t just cleaning — it’s understanding your duct system’s vulnerability. Homes in Vancouver’s newer developments like Salmon Creek or Ridgefield often have encapsulated crawlspaces, which dramatically reduce this condensation risk. Older homes in Arnada or Lincoln don’t. Spring: Pollen, Construction Dust, and Post-Winter Assessment
Vancouver’s spring brings two distinct duct stressors: the pollen explosion from Clark County’s extensive tree canopy, and construction dust from one of the Pacific Northwest’s most active development corridors. From March through May, we’re cleaning systems that simultaneously face biological and particulate loading that most national duct-cleaning guides don’t address together.
The pollen factor is straightforward but underestimated. Vancouver’s alder, birch, and cedar pollen peaks in April. Standard filters catch some, but pollen particles range from 10-100 microns — smaller than visible dust. What slips past settles in ducts. When summer humidity rises, that pollen becomes a nutrient source for other biological activity. We’ve opened spring ducts in homes near Vancouver’s greenbelts to find pollen residue coating duct walls in visible yellow layers.
The construction factor is more geographically specific. Vancouver’s growth along the 205 corridor, in Felida, and east toward Camas produces sustained particulate from grading, concrete cutting, and vehicle traffic. Homes within half a mile of active construction sites — and in spring 2024-2025, that’s much of Vancouver — experience filter loading at 2-3x normal rates. That overload means more bypass, more duct deposition.
Spring inspection priorities:
- Check filter loading rate. If you’re changing filters monthly instead of quarterly, your ducts are receiving bypass load. This is your earliest warning.
- Inspect outdoor condenser and intake areas. Spring growth and construction debris block airflow, reducing system efficiency and increasing runtime that pulls more particulate through leaks.
- Assess duct integrity after winter stress. Thermal expansion from heating season loosens connections. Spring is when we find the most separations in flex duct — particularly in Vancouver’s homes with attic installations, where summer heat will soon make access difficult.
- Schedule cleaning before wildfire season. Clean ducts in May handle summer smoke events better. Pre-loaded ducts compound the problem.

Summer: Wildfire Smoke Preparation and Recovery
Vancouver’s summer duct challenge isn’t heat — it’s smoke. The 2020 Labor Day fires made this visceral for every Clark County homeowner, but it’s become a recurring pattern: August and September now carry predictable air quality emergencies. Your duct system’s response to these events determines whether you’re protected or actively circulating hazardous particulate.
Here’s what actually happens during smoke events. When AQI hits 150+ — which occurred for 9 consecutive days in September 2020 and multiple shorter periods in 2021-2023 — standard MERV 8 filters become essentially transparent to PM2.5 particles. Those particles enter your duct system. If your ducts have any leaks in return pathways (and most Vancouver homes do), they pull unfiltered attic or crawlspace air during the high-runtime periods that extreme heat or smoke-driven closure creates.
Pre-smoke preparation:
- Upgrade to MERV 13 minimum, or MERV 16 if your blower can handle the static pressure — check manufacturer specs or have your HVAC contractor verify
- Seal known duct leaks; even 10% return leakage means 10% of your circulated air bypassed filtration entirely during smoke events
- Identify “clean rooms” with portable HEPA filtration for extreme events — typically bedrooms with minimal duct vents and windows that seal well
- Test your system’s “recirculate” function before you need it; many Vancouver homeowners discover this setting doesn’t work when smoke arrives
Post-smoke assessment — this is what competitors miss:
After smoke clears, most homeowners change their filter and assume they’re done. We’ve inspected Vancouver ducts in November that still carried September smoke residue. The fine particulate (PM2.5 and below) adheres to duct walls, particularly in humid summer conditions that precede fall heating. When you finally turn heat on, that residue re-enters your air.

Building Your Vancouver-Specific Seasonal Calendar
Generic national recommendations fail Vancouver homeowners because they ignore our specific climate pattern: mild wet winters, dry summers, concentrated wildfire smoke, and active construction. Here’s how to build a calendar based on your home’s actual characteristics.
Factor 1: Home Age and Duct Material
| Home Era | Typical Duct Type | Primary Seasonal Risk | Recommended Focus |
|---|---|---|---|
| Pre-1970 | Galvanized steel, often uninsulated | Winter condensation, corrosion | Fall inspection for rust; winter moisture monitoring |
| 1970-1990 | Fiberglass duct board or early flex duct | Debris retention, fiber degradation | Spring integrity check; cleaning every 2-3 years |
| 1990-2010 | Fiberglass-lined metal or flex duct | Construction dust loading, pollen | Spring assessment; smoke-season filtration |
| 2010-present | Sealed flex or rigid metal, often encapsulated | Filter bypass from tight construction | Annual flow verification; filtration optimization |
Factor 2: HVAC Location
Crawlspace systems in Vancouver face moisture and mold risk; attic systems face extreme temperature cycling and access difficulty; closet or conditioned space systems have fewer environmental stressors but often poorer return air design. We’ve found that homes in Vancouver’s hillside areas — above 500 feet elevation in neighborhoods like North Image or Bagley Downs — with attic ductwork experience the most thermal expansion damage. Flatland homes near the river with crawlspace systems face more moisture issues.
Factor 3: Occupant Sensitivity
Families with allergy sufferers, elderly residents, or infants should compress the maintenance interval. A home with standard occupancy might schedule professional inspection every 18-24 months; sensitive-occupancy homes benefit from annual assessment, with cleaning frequency driven by borescope findings rather than calendar.
Sample Vancouver Calendar:
- September: Pre-heating inspection, filter upgrade, wildfire smoke assessment if applicable
- November: First heating cycle monitoring — note odors, uneven heating, filter loading
- February: Mid-winter crawlspace duct check (visual if accessible, or professional if musty odors present)
- April: Post-pollen inspection, pre-construction-season filter protocol
- May: Professional cleaning if indicated by inspection findings
- July-August: Wildfire preparation: filtration upgrade, system recirculate test, clean room setup

Common Mistakes to Avoid
- Treating duct cleaning as a one-time event. Vancouver’s seasonal variation means contamination types change; spring pollen residue and fall smoke particulate require different approaches, and a single cleaning can’t address both if they’re six months apart.
- Assuming new filters protect ducts. Filters protect equipment and reduce airborne particulate; they don’t remove existing duct deposits. We’ve cleaned ducts in Vancouver homes with religious monthly filter changes that still held years of accumulated debris.
- Ignoring the “first burn” smell. That October odor isn’t normal — it’s a signal that your heating cycle is distributing baked organic material. Address it before it becomes your baseline air quality.
- Using consumer-grade duct cleaning attachments. Big-box store brush kits on shop vacuums don’t produce sufficient agitation or containment. We’ve been called to Vancouver homes where DIY attempts pushed debris deeper into duct runs or damaged flex duct connections.
- Neglecting dryer vents in seasonal planning. Dryer vent blockage compounds HVAC strain and creates fire risk. In Vancouver’s lint-heavy environment from cottonwood and other fibrous trees, this needs annual attention separate from duct cleaning.
- Waiting for visible dust at registers. By the time you see dust exiting vents, your system has significant interior loading. Register dust is the last symptom, not the first.
- Assuming all duct cleaning is equivalent. Contact cleaning (brush/agitation) versus negative air extraction versus compressed air — each has appropriate applications. In Vancouver’s older homes with fragile duct board, aggressive methods cause damage that careful contact cleaning avoids.
When to Call a Professional
Some seasonal duct tasks are homeowner-appropriate: filter changes, register cleaning, visual inspection of accessible ductwork. Others require professional assessment — particularly when safety, contamination, or system integrity are involved.
Call for professional inspection when you notice musty odors that persist beyond first-heating cycle, visible mold at registers or in accessible duct sections, uneven heating or cooling that suggests duct separation, or any ductwork in unconditioned spaces that hasn’t been assessed in over two years. Post-wildfire smoke exposure also warrants professional evaluation — the fine particulate involved isn’t visible to homeowners and doesn’t respond to standard cleaning methods.

Smoke residue doesn’t permanently damage metal or flex ductwork, but fine particulate becomes deeply embedded in fiberglass-lined ducts and can accelerate degradation of duct board. The real risk is sustained exposure to occupants — post-smoke professional cleaning removes residue that filters and surface cleaning can’t address. Musty heating odors indicate moisture accumulation in your duct system — typically condensation in crawlspace runs or residual moisture from summer humidity that supported microbial growth in duct debris. It’s not normal and shouldn’t be ignored. Professional inspection with borescope visualization identifies the source; our cleaning process addresses both the biological growth and the debris that supports it.
Regular filter changes protect your equipment and reduce airborne particulate, but they don’t remove existing duct deposits. Filters capture what passes through them; they don’t clean duct walls. We’ve inspected Vancouver homes with pristine filter records and significant interior duct loading — particularly in homes with return air leaks that bypass filtration entirely. The Bottom Line
Vancouver’s four seasons each present distinct duct system challenges: fall’s first-heating debris release, winter’s condensation and microbial risk, spring’s pollen and construction dust compounding, and summer’s wildfire smoke exposure. Treating duct care as a single annual task misses these seasonal stress points and allows compounding contamination that affects air quality and system efficiency. The most effective approach matches specific actions to each season, calibrated to your home’s age, duct material, and HVAC configuration — not generic national recommendations. Build your calendar, monitor the warning signs we’ve outlined, and address problems before they become your baseline air quality.
